Provided is a visual line estimating apparatus which can obtain a high accurate visual line estimating result with suppressed errors without delays even if the visual line measuring result includes the significant errors caused by the false detection of the pupil. The visual line estimating apparatus 200 comprises: an image inputting section 201 operable to take an image of a human; a visual line measurement section 202 operable to measure a direction of a visual line on the basis of the taken image; a visual line measuring result storing section 211 operable to store therein visual line measuring results previously measured, a representative value extracting section 212 operable to extract a previous representative value; and a visual line determining section 213 operable to judge whether or not a difference between the representative value and the visual line measuring result is lower than a predetermined threshold to determine a visual line estimating result from the representative value and the visual line measuring result.